Galgano Guidotti (1148 – 3 December 1181) was a Catholic saint from Tuscany born in Chiusdino, in the modern province of Siena, Italy. His mother's name was Dionigia, while his father's name (Guido or Guidotto) only appeared in a document dated in the 16th century, when the last name Guidotti was attributed. The … See more The son of a feudal lord, Galgano became a knight, and is said to have led a ruthless life in his early years. Galgano died in 1181.
